Stat Priority
Stats directly affect a Restoration Shaman's Healer performance, appearing on gear, consumables, enchantments, and gems.
They have diminishing returns after reaching +20% from gear, so proper balance ensures the best results.
Secondary Stats
- 5% Critical Strike +0
- 6% Haste +3767
- 114% Mastery +20973
- 25% Versatility +19203
Stat priority
- Mastery
- Versatility
- Haste
- Critical Strike

Embellishments
Embellishments add special effects to crafted gear. Only two can be equipped, so selection is important.

Enchantments
Enchantments enhance gear with additional stats or special procs. Most are crafted by Enchanters, leg enchants come from Leatherworkers, and some slot-specific options appear through seasonal content.

Gems
Gems provide focused secondary stat bonuses to help fine‑tune builds. They are crafted by Jewelcrafters and socketed into gear.
Sockets can be added to Necklaces and Rings with the Magnificent Jeweler's Setting , or to other gear through seasonal vendor items.
